    Long description:

    "

    This book discusses the Universal Design for Learning (UDL) framework as essential tool for creating inclusive and effective mathematics classrooms and lessons in the twenty-first century. It emphasizes sustainable applications that directly address topics related to SDG 4 (Quality Education) and SDG 5 (Gender Equality). This book focuses on how UDL espouses the use of multiple means of representation, engagement and expression to accommodate the diverse learning needs of all students. It further highlights the need to integrate UDL principles in mathematics lessons, educators design instruction that is compelling, inclusive, accessible, engaging and challenging for every student, regardless of the characteristics (like abilities or backgrounds) that they bring into the classrooms.

    This book studies how the UDL principles can be used to design instruction that promotes critical thinking, problem-solving, collaboration, innovation and technological literacy, which are vital skills in the twenty-first century. It offers a holistic, research-driven and practical guide to UDL-based mathematics teaching, making it an invaluable resource for educators seeking impactful and inclusive strategies. What makes this book unique is its comprehensive approach to applying UDL, specifically in the context of mathematics education. The project outlines theoretical underpinnings and provides practical strategies and tools teachers can implement in their classrooms. The project offers research-based insights and real-world applications, thus making it a valuable knowledge resource for educators seeking to enhance their teaching practices.
